Description

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model relates to the production technology field of methane chloride, specifically relates to a system of conveniently cleaning carbon deposition in methane chloride quench tower. BACKGROUND

[0002] The preparation of methane chloride from methyl chloride and chlorine is the mainstream technology for preparing methane chloride at present, and the thermal chlorination reaction of methyl chloride and chlorine is carried out in a chlorination reactor, a large amount of heat is released during the reaction process, and the reaction discharge temperature is high. The reaction discharge mainly contains hydrogen chloride, unreacted methyl chloride, dichloromethane, trichloromethane and carbon tetrachloride. In order to improve the utilization rate of methyl chloride, it is necessary to separate methyl chloride from the reaction discharge and re-enter the reaction. First, the boiling point of hydrogen chloride is used to deeply cool the reaction discharge, and hydrogen chloride gas and crude methane chloride liquid are separated by gas-liquid separation. The crude methane chloride liquid enters the recycling tower for rectification, so as to separate methyl chloride from dichloromethane and other substances.

[0003] The thermal chlorination reaction temperature of methyl chloride and chlorine is about 410 DEG C, so the pipeline temperature from the chlorination reactor to the quench tower is relatively high. In the production process, methyl chloride, dichloromethane and other substances are prone to carbon deposition, and the carbon deposition enters the quench tower with the material and adheres to the inner wall of the quench tower. If it is not cleaned in time, it will block the pipeline and affect the production. At present, the quench tower is usually cleaned regularly, but the carbon deposition is difficult to clean, and it needs to be heated by steam before it can be cleaned down, which is complicated, time-consuming and laborious. And dichloromethane and trichloromethane in the material are highly hazardous media, which also increases the risk of poisoning of the cleaning personnel. UTILITY MODEL CONTENTS

DETAILED DESCRIPTION

[0017] In order to make the person skilled in the art better understand the technical scheme in the utility model, the technical scheme of the utility model will be clearly and completely described below in combination with the embodiments of the utility model.

[0018] Embodiment 1

[0019] As shown in the figure, the embodiment provides a system for conveniently cleaning carbon deposition in a methane chlorinated quench tower, a circulating filter pipeline 2 is connected to a tower bottom discharge port of the quench tower 1, a circulating pump one 3 is installed on the circulating filter pipeline 2, a pre-pump filter one 4 is arranged on the circulating filter pipeline 2 at an inlet end of the circulating pump one 3, a precision filter one 5 is arranged on the circulating filter pipeline 2 at an outlet end of the circulating pump one 3, differential pressure gauges 6 are connected to both ends of the precision filter one 5 on the circulating filter pipeline 2, and the circulating pump one 3 and the differential pressure gauges 6 are electrically connected to a control system respectively. Figure 1 The tower bottom material of the quench tower 1 enters the pre-pump filter one 4 through the circulating filter pipeline 2, the preliminarily filtered material is punched back into the quench tower 1 by the circulating pump one 3, and before this, the material is further filtered by the precision filter one 5, so that the carbon deposition entrained by the material in the quench tower 1 is filtered out, the carbon deposition adhered to the inner wall of the quench tower 1 is greatly reduced, the pipeline is prevented from being blocked, and the normal production is ensured. Meanwhile, a high differential pressure limit value of the differential pressure gauges 6 can be preset in the control system, an alarm is given when the differential pressure of both ends of the precision filter one 5 exceeds the high differential pressure limit value, and it is indicated that the filter element of the precision filter one 5 needs to be replaced.

[0020] The embodiment can perform on-line circulating filtration and cleaning of the tower bottom material of the quench tower 1, ensure that the material in the quench tower 1 is clean, and the filter element can be replaced according to the alarm of the high differential pressure limit value of the differential pressure gauges 6 of both ends of the precision filter one 5, the precision filter one 5 is prevented from being blocked, and the smooth filtration is ensured.

[0021] Embodiment 2

[0022] On the basis of embodiment 1, as shown in the figure, the embodiment provides a system for conveniently cleaning carbon deposition in a methane chlorinated quench tower, a circulating filter pipeline 2 is connected to a tower bottom discharge port of the quench tower 1, a circulating pump one 3 is installed on the circulating filter pipeline 2, a pre-pump filter one 4 is arranged on the circulating filter pipeline 2 at an inlet end of the circulating pump one 3, a precision filter one 5 is arranged on the circulating filter pipeline 2 at an outlet end of the circulating pump one 3, differential pressure gauges 6 are connected to both ends of the precision filter one 5 on the circulating filter pipeline 2, and the circulating pump one 3 and the differential pressure gauges 6 are electrically connected to a control system respectively.

[0023] Figure 1 ​As shown, the quench tower 1 is provided with a liquid level meter 7, and the circulating filter pipeline 2 is provided with a flow meter 8 and an adjusting valve 9 at the outlet end of the circulating pump 1, and the liquid level meter 7, the flow meter 8 and the adjusting valve 9 are electrically connected with the control system. The low limit value and the high limit value of the liquid level of the quench tower 1 can be preset in the control system. When the liquid level meter 7 detects that the liquid level of the quench tower 1 is lower than the low limit value, it indicates that the amount of the material at the bottom of the quench tower 1 is too small, and at this time, continuing to circulate and filter through the circulating pump 1 will cause the circulating pump 1 to idle and other problems, which is not conducive to the protection of the equipment. Therefore, the control system can control the circulating pump 1 to be closed to stop the circulation and filtration of the material at the bottom of the quench tower 1, or the opening of the adjusting valve 9 can be adjusted to reduce the flow of the material in the circulating filter pipeline 2, until the liquid level of the quench tower 1 reaches the high limit value, which indicates that the liquid level of the quench tower 1 is stable, and at this time, the opening of the adjusting valve 9 can be restored to increase the flow of the material in the circulating filter pipeline 2.

[0024] Example 3

[0025] Based on example 1, as shown in the figure, Figure 1 The pre-pump filter 4 and the two ends of the circulating pump 1 are connected in parallel with a standby circulating filter pipeline 10, the standby circulating filter pipeline 10 is provided with a circulating pump 11, and the pre-pump filter 2 is installed on the standby circulating filter pipeline 10 at the inlet end of the circulating pump 11; the two ends of the precision filter 1 are connected in parallel with a precision filter 13 through a pipeline, and the two ends of the precision filter 1 and the precision filter 13 are respectively provided with a valve 14, and the circulating pump 11 and the valve 14 are electrically connected with the control system.

[0026] The two pre-pump filters and the precision filters are one active and one standby, which can ensure that when one of the pre-pump filters or the precision filters is replaced or repaired, it can be switched to the other standby pre-pump filter or precision filter to ensure the continuous filtration of the material.

[0027] Example 4

[0028] Based on example 1, as shown in the figure, Figure 1 The circulating filter pipeline 2 is provided with a sight glass 15 at the outlet of the quench tower 1, which can facilitate the observation of the turbidity of the material in the circulating filter pipeline 2; the quench tower 1 is provided with a temperature sensor 16 and a pressure sensor 17, and the temperature sensor 16 and the pressure sensor 17 are electrically connected with the control system, and through the temperature sensor 16 and the pressure sensor 17, the temperature and the pressure in the quench tower 1 can be monitored in real time.
